I find myself not able to delete those names from my contacts...
Me neither. I’ve probably mentioned before that in looking into what might have become of an old friend/acquaintance/coworker/etc. I find that said person has either died or that our mutual acquaintances, who might cast some light on the matter, have died themselves.

The generation ahead of me is almost entirely gone now. My nonagenarian mother (she had us young; married at 17, widowed with three babies at 21) is still with us, as are a couple of aunts, but my last surviving uncles both died recently — one a few months back, the other last week.

Among the advantages of advancing years has been, in my case, a growing awareness of what I do not know, which, as it turns out, is almost everything. I know a little bit about a few things, and quite a bit about far fewer things, but I defer to those with real expertise in their particular fields to hold forth on those matters. It’s liberating, really, this not having to have an opinion, this not having to burden myself with it.

I’m reminded of what I heard many years ago: You had better consult with the youngsters now, while they still know everything.
